Tesco was established in 1919 by Jack Cohen, who set up an unassuming stall in London's East End. He wanted customers to select their own products. It was a huge success and he expanded the business. He began selling goods to other businesses.

The company has expanded its business to include clothing, books and electronic devices furniture, as well as financial services. Its stores include hypermarkets of various sizes, discount supermarkets, and convenience stores. The supermarkets have a wide selection of fresh food items including meat, dairy bakery, frozen foods, and ready meals. Also, they have toiletries and beauty products.

Tesco launched its first US stores in 2007 under the name Fresh & Easy. The company had planned to establish a coast-to-coast business and built a costly infrastructure. In 2013, however, Tesco announced it would quit the United States.

After careful consideration and thorough research, the decision to withdraw from the US market was taken. Tesco has invested more than $1 billion in the US operations. The company also worked for 20 years on its entry into the American market. It recruited Dunhumby as a customer research company and sent executives to American homes to observe what families consumed and where they went to shop.
